Interceptions of boat people rise
From Times Wire Reports
The U.S. Coast Guard has been intercepting more boat people crossing from Cuba to the Straits of Florida in the last three months, and the U.S. Border Patrol has been processing rising numbers turning up at the U.S.-Mexico border, officials said.
A U.S. Customs and Border Protection spokesman said 2,819 Cubans had reached Florida so far this year, compared with 3,076 in all of last year.
